Different kinds of rowing machines
There are a variety of rowing machines, each with each having its own set of characteristics. For instance, some rowing machines feature an resistance system that can be altered to increase or less difficult, while other machines have a preset resistance that is not adjustable. Also, some machines have action that simulates actual rowing on water, whereas other models do not. Other characteristics that can differ among different kinds of rowing machines include the number of flywheels, number of resistance level, and the type that displays (analog or digital) as well as the capability to fold down for storage.
Why would you want to use a machine for rowing?
Rowing machines offer a great exercise for the entire body. They're low impact, so they're comfortable for joints and also work both your lower and upper body. Rowing machines are also an excellent way to get your heart rate going and boost your fitness level. There are three types of rowing equipment which include air rowers and water rowers, as well as magnetic rowers. Air rowers make use of the power of a fan to generate resistance, water rowers employ paddles in a pool of water to create resistance, and magnetic rowers make use of magnets to create resistance. Each type of rowing machine offers advantages and disadvantages. Air rowers are the most affordableoption, but they're also most likely to be loud and generate a lot of vibration. Water rowers are the most quiet option, but they're also the most expensive. Magnetic rowers are somewhere in the middle of cost, however they give a smooth and seamless rowing, which is very gentle on joints.

Tips of the rowing machine
If you're using a machine to row at the gym, you need that you know how to utilize the machine to make the most of your exercise. Here are some suggestions for starting: make sure that the footrests are adjusted so that your feet are secured and comfortably. You should sit straight, placing your spine against the seat, and hold the handle in both hands. Once you've gotten in place then extend your legs outwards and then lean forward slightly towards your waist. Begin rowing with your legs and pulling the handle toward your chest. Be sure to keep the back straight as well as your core active throughout the row. Once you've reached the end of the stroke then reverse the motion by pulling your legs first towards you, then release the handle. Repeat the motion until you have a set number of reps or for a specified amount of time.
